Description
Panegyrist of the emperor Honorius and propagandist of Stilicho, the late antique poet Claudian has traditionally been the preserve of historians rather than literary critics. This book examines Claudian as epic poet and literary successor of Virgil, showing how he presented contemporary events in terms of classical epic.
